Find your VPN credentials for manual configuration
To find your VPN credentials log into the PureVPN Member Area. Click π here to visit Member Area.
- Login to the Member Area using your PureVPN registered email address and password. 
- From manage account section, go to the Subscriptions tab. 
- On subscriptions tab scroll down to be able to view your VPN credentials. 
- You will be able to see and copy your VPN credentials. 
- Note down your PureVPN username and click Eye icon to make your password visible and use it in the manual configuration 
How to connect PureVPN manually on macOS
- Run Easy SSTP from applications. 
- Type your Mac password and click OK. 
- Click Easy SSTP icon from Menu bar and select Configure... 
- Click New. 
- Once the new windows open, please enter the information mentioned below for the following fields: 
- Connection Type: Password from the drop-down menu 
- Insert Connection Name: PureVPN SSTP 
- Insert the desired server: Please refer to the server address shared in the above note. 
- Enter your PureVPN credentials. Here is how you can π find your VPN credentials. 
- Click Save. 
- Click Easy SSTP icon from menu bar and select newly created PureVPN SSTP connection.

- Click Easy SSTP icon from menu bar and select Shows Status... to verify connection.
